46th Street & 46th Avenue Housing Development Proposal
A new residential building with 48 apartments is proposed for the property located at 4516-4556 46th Street East (northwest corner of the intersection of 46th Street & 46th Avenue). The project is proposed by Master Development and The Lander Group; the building would be managed by At Home Apartments once completed. The project would utilize the existing footings and foundation that were previously installed for a 27-unit residential building that was approved in 2005.
The property is zoned OR-2, High Density Office Residence district. The zoning variances and approvals for the previous 27-unit residential building proposal have since expired. The current proposal will require the following land use applications by approved by the City Planning Commission:
- Conditional use permit for 48 dwelling units.
- Variance to reduce the minimum lot area per dwelling unit from 602 square feet to 426 square feet, a variance of 29.2 percent.
- Variance to reduce the rear yard setback from 11 feet to 8 feet.
- Variance to reduce the north side yard setback from 11 feet to 10 feet.
- Variance to reduce the front yard setback from 21 feet to 7 feet.
- Variance to reduce the drive aisle width for one surface parking stall to 0 feet and reduce the drive aisle width for seven enclosed stalls to 0 feet.
- Variance to increase the maximum lot coverage from 70 percent to 73.2 percent.
- Variance to increase the maximum amount of impervious surface from 85 percent to 87.5 percent.
- Site plan review.
The project is scheduled to go before the City Planning Commission at its meeting on Monday August 15th at 4:30pm in Room 317, City Hall. An agenda for the meeting will be available on the City website here approximately one week in advance. The City Planning Commission meeting is a public hearing format, with opportunity for community members to speak. Feedback may also be submitted in advance of the meeting by emailing Kimberly Holien, City Planner at Kimberly.holien@ci.minneapolis.mn.us. All feedback will be collected and attached to the staff report that the City Planner provides to the City Planning Commission.
